### Changed defaults — Threxall migration runner

Zero-downtime is now the default mode: migrations run expand/contract with dual writes enabled automatically, and the contract phase requires an explicit manual approval. Reviewers should confirm callers no longer pass the deprecated lock flag, as it is now ignored. The updated default configuration values appear below.

service settings:
WENATH_PIN=5007
WENATH_METRICS_HOST=metrics.wenath.tolvaqlabs.corp
WENATH_LOG_LEVEL=debug
WENATH_TENANT=rusox

Dispatch latency under mixed-traffic load improved roughly eight percent, and the idle-car parking heuristic no longer oscillates between adjacent floors. No schema changes this release, so downstream dashboards need no migration. Release manager: please review the artifact and confirm promotion by Thursday. The candidate is identified by the build token directly below.

trace token, fafog-kageg: htk4_98e6

[ ] Confirm decommission of the homegrown job queue (Quillrun) before signing the new escrow material. The replacement, Lanternbatch, now handles all signing-job dispatch for the Verdane Labs HSM cluster, and the legacy queue's worker credentials have been revoked. Security reviewer should verify that no Quillrun daemons remain on the ceremony hosts and that the audit log shows zero enqueue events in the past 30 days. Once verified, initial the ceremony sheet and record the recovery passphrase provided below.

vault phrase of tajef-tafog = istox-sorax-zorox-casok-holox-kelix-weneth-drueth-casion

Handover note — Crumbwheel order cutoffs.

Welcome aboard. The bakery cutoff rule in Crumbwheel closes same-day orders at 14:00 local to each storefront, not UTC — this has bitten us twice. Holiday overrides live in the calendar service and take precedence silently, so always check there first when a cutoff looks wrong. To unlock the calendar service's admin console after a restart, enter the recovery passphrase below.

vault phrase of bagap-bahaf = silion-pelox-sorox-casdor-quenwyn-fraax-eliox-praael-kelion-quenvan-kasox-rusael-norius-belvan